Rocky, sorry to hear of your struggles. Just my experience with auto insurance companies, if they total a car they will offer you a set amount and you can deduct the price to buy the unit back from that price.

As for the Teton which is a quality home, if it is a rubber roof and just that and the wood under it got damaged that is not that expensive to repair. I know that when we purchased our 5er the rubber roof

had quite a bit of damage. I called a repair shop and they quoted us $7000. So we called around and got all the materials for $1200. and about $200. to add another layer of 7/16 plywood under the rubber.

Now I am telling you this because meeting you at the 2013 rally I feel that you guys may have a great out pouring of friends that would be more then happy to do the labor.

Ruth and I did ours and it took us 4 long days, and that's with just us two. And if we weren't in Cal. getting our truck worked on I would consider coming out to help with installing it. We hope you heal fast and

hope this will help in some way.

Or, if you want to see the new website I developed, look at Diamond https://diamondcampground.wordpress.com/

 

We are not an "RV Resort". The campground is at 8500' on the flank of Pikes Peak. We try to keep it more rustic. No swimming pool - you could not use it at this elevation - it was 46* this morning. :) But we do have a modern bathhouse and decent Internet, most of the time. Most of the sites are nestled in the pines or aspen. Most are pretty spacious as these things go, but some are tight. It just depends. We have big rig sites, but you have to reserve.
